The Role of Substance P in the Marginal Division of the Neostriatum in Learning and Memory is Mediated Through the Neurokinin 1 Receptor in Rats

Abstract: Substance P (SP) is a neuropeptide that plays an important role in inflammation, respiration, pain, aggression, anxiety, and learning and memory mainly through its high affinity neurokinin 1 receptor (NK1R). The marginal division (MrD) is a pan-shaped subdivision in the caudomedial margin of the neostriatum in the mammalian brain and is known to be involved in learning and memory. “…Transgenic mouse models of AD based on the known genetic origins of familial AD have significantly contributed to the understanding of the molecular mechanisms involved in the onset and progression of the disease 52 . Studies using animal models showed that administration of SP provides protection from the cognitive impairment induced by Aβ infusion 53 , prevents Aβ induced neuronal loss 54 and improves memory functions 55 . Despite the observed benefits, it is unlikely that administration of SP will be used as a treatment of AD as it induces multiple effects including risk of emesis and nausea.…”

“…NK1R are expressed on interneurons in the dorsal striatum (Richardson et al, 2000) where they are thought to have a role in synaptic plasticity and learning (Liu et al, 2011). The majority of these NK1R-expressing interneurons are cholinergic (Gerfen, 1991), but some are GABAergic (NPY/somatostatin (SOM)/NOS-expressing) (Kawaguchi et al, 1995;Li et al, 2002).…”

“…Knocking down NK1R activity in the MrD by using an antisense oligonucleotide against NK1R messenger RNA (mRNA) inhibited learning and memory of rats in a Y-maze behavioral test. Thus, NK1R is likely to mediate the role of the MrD in learning and memory [8]. …”
